I. Planning and Design: The Foundation of a Successful Hikvision System

Before any hardware is purchased or installed, thorough planning is paramount. This stage involves a detailed site survey to assess the area requiring surveillance. Key considerations include:
Identifying Security Needs: Determining the specific security risks and vulnerabilities is the first step. This involves identifying potential threats and determining the level of protection required. Are you focusing on perimeter security, internal monitoring, or a combination of both? What are the potential threats? Theft, vandalism, intrusion, or something else?
Camera Selection: Hikvision offers a diverse range of cameras, each with unique features and capabilities. Choosing the right camera type (e.g., PTZ, dome, bullet, thermal) depends on the environment, lighting conditions, required resolution, and field of view. Factors such as IR illumination for night vision, weatherproofing, and lens type must also be considered.
Network Infrastructure: A robust network is crucial for transmitting video data. This includes assessing existing network bandwidth, considering potential network latency, and planning for sufficient network switches, routers, and cabling. Understanding PoE (Power over Ethernet) requirements and planning for adequate power supplies is vital.
Storage Capacity: Determining the required storage capacity for recorded video footage is critical. This depends on the number of cameras, recording resolution, and retention time. Hikvision offers various storage solutions, including NVRs (Network Video Recorders) and cloud storage options. Choosing the right storage solution depends on budget, scalability requirements, and data redundancy needs.
Software and Management: Hikvision offers powerful video management software (VMS) for centralized monitoring and management. Selecting the appropriate VMS and understanding its features and capabilities is crucial for efficient system operation. This includes understanding user roles and permissions, alarm management, and video analytics capabilities.

II. Implementation and Installation: A Precise and Methodical Approach

Successful implementation involves precise installation and configuration of Hikvision hardware and software. This stage requires skilled technicians who are familiar with:
Camera Mounting and Cabling: Cameras must be mounted securely and strategically to provide optimal coverage. Proper cabling is crucial for reliable video transmission and power supply. This includes understanding cable types, connectors, and proper grounding techniques.
Network Configuration: Configuring network settings, including IP addresses, subnet masks, and gateways, is crucial for seamless network integration. Understanding VLANs and network segmentation can improve security and performance.
NVR/Storage Configuration: Configuring the NVR to record video from connected cameras, setting recording schedules, and managing storage space are critical steps. Understanding RAID configurations and data backup strategies are important for data redundancy and system reliability.
VMS Setup and Configuration: Installing and configuring the Hikvision VMS software involves setting up user accounts, configuring recording settings, and integrating with other security systems. Understanding the VMS interface and its features is crucial for efficient system management.
Testing and Verification: After installation, thorough testing is necessary to verify that the system is functioning correctly. This involves checking camera functionality, network connectivity, recording capabilities, and overall system performance.

III. Maintenance and Ongoing Management: Ensuring System Longevity and Performance

Regular maintenance is essential for ensuring the long-term performance and reliability of a Hikvision surveillance system. This includes:
Regular System Checks: Periodic checks of camera functionality, network connectivity, recording capacity, and storage health are crucial for identifying potential issues early on.
Firmware Updates: Regularly updating the firmware of cameras and NVRs is essential for patching security vulnerabilities and improving system performance. Hikvision regularly releases firmware updates to address bugs and enhance features.
Storage Management: Regularly monitoring storage capacity and implementing data archiving strategies are crucial for preventing data loss and maintaining system performance.
Security Audits: Regular security audits are important for identifying and addressing potential vulnerabilities in the system. This includes checking for unauthorized access and ensuring the system is protected from cyber threats.
Proactive Maintenance: Implementing a proactive maintenance plan can help prevent issues before they arise. This might involve regular cleaning of cameras, checking cable connections, and ensuring proper ventilation for equipment.
